In The Kitchen With Kanta : Vegetable Soup

This week I’m keeping it simple and healthy with this nutritious and delicious vegetable soup. It’s tasty, and filling; packed with different veggies, and perfect for an easy lunch or an afternoon snack. This soup is great not only if you are trying to lose weight but also if you are trying to add more vegetables to your everyday diet. It is very versatile meaning you can add any vegetables that you want and it is gluten. So definitely try it.

Ingredients

  • 2 whole Bell peppers, chopped
  • 680g Broccoli florets
  • 1kg Cabbage, chopped
  • 340g Carrots, diced
  • 2 cloves Garlic, minced
  • 340g Green beans, cut into 1 inch pieces
  • 1 small Onion, diced
  • 1/2 tsp Thyme & basil (optional)
  • 1 can diced Tomatoes, low sodium
  • 680g of Courgettes, sliced
  • 1.4l Beef/Chicken broth, low sodium
  • 2 tbsp Tomato paste
  • Salt and Pepper to taste

Method

In a large pot cook the onion & garlic over a medium heat until they are slightly softened. Add carrots, cabbage & green beans and cook for an additional 5 minutes.

Stir in the bell peppers, un-drained tomatoes, broth, tomato paste, bay leaves, salt and pepper; and simmer for 6-7 minutes. Add in the courgettes & broccoli and simmer for a final 5 minutes or until softened. Add extra salt and pepper to taste before serving.

Serving

Serve hot and enjoy
